Why Windows Update Errors Occur in HP Laptops

Windows updates fail for many reasons. The most common ones include:

  • Corrupted update files

  • Slow or unstable internet connection

  • Outdated drivers

  • Insufficient storage

  • System file corruption

  • Damaged update cache

  • Interference from antivirus or firewall

Understanding the cause makes fixing the problem easier.


Step-by-Step Solutions to Fix Windows Update Error

Below are practical, safe solutions you can try immediately.


1. Restart Your Laptop and Try Again

It sounds simple, but a fresh restart clears temporary glitches.
Close all apps → Restart → Try updating again.

If it still fails, move to the next steps.


2. Check Internet Connection

A slow or unstable connection can interrupt updates.

  • Use a stable WiFi network

  • Avoid public WiFi

  • Restart your router

3. Free Up Storage Space

Windows updates need enough space to install.

Try:

  • Deleting old files

  • Removing unused apps

  • Running Disk Cleanup

  • Emptying recycle bin

Free at least 10–15 GB for smooth updates.


4. Run Windows Update Troubleshooter

This tool automatically detects and fixes update problems.

How to run:

  1. Open Settings

  2. Go to System → Troubleshoot → Other troubleshooters

  3. Click Run under Windows Update

Let it complete and then try updating again.


5. Clear Windows Update Cache (SoftwareDistribution Folder)

Corrupted update cache is one of the biggest reasons for update failures.

Steps:

  1. Press Windows + R

  2. Type services.msc

  3. Stop Windows Update service

  4. Go to this folder:

    C:\Windows\SoftwareDistribution
  5. Delete all files inside

  6. Start the Windows Update service again

Now try the update—this method works in most cases.


6. Use SFC & DISM to Repair System Files

Corrupted system files can prevent updates from completing.

Run these commands (as Administrator):

Step 1: SFC Scan

sfc /scannow

Step 2: DISM Commands

D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/ScanHealth
D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/RestoreHealth

These tools repair damaged files and restore Windows integrity.

7. Update Drivers (Especially Chipset & Graphics)

Outdated or faulty drivers can block updates.

Steps:

  1. Open Device Manager

  2. Update:

    • Display Adapter

    • System Devices

    • Network Adapter

  3. Restart your laptop

HP Support Assistant can also update drivers automatically.


8. Disable Antivirus Temporarily

Some antivirus programs block Windows updates.

Try:

  • Turning off real-time protection

  • Pausing antivirus for installation

After updating, turn it back on.


9. Perform a Clean Boot

A clean boot loads only essential services.

Steps:

  1. Press Windows + R

  2. Type msconfig

  3. Go to Services tab → Check Hide all Microsoft services

  4. Click Disable all

  5. Restart

After reboot, try installing updates again.


10. Reset Windows Update Components (Advanced Fix)

If all else fails, resetting update components can resolve hidden issues.

Run these commands one by one in Command Prompt (Admin):

net stop bits
net stop wuauserv
net stop appidsvc
net stop cryptsvc
ren C:\Windows\SoftwareDistribution SoftwareDistribution.old
ren C:\Windows\System32\catroot2 catroot2.old
net start bits
net start wuauserv
net start appidsvc
net start cryptsvc

Then restart your laptop.

FAQs – Windows Update Error in HP Laptops

Q1. Why do Windows updates take so long?

Large updates, slow internet, or old hardware can increase installation time.

Q2. Can I skip a Windows update if it fails?

It’s not recommended. Updates improve security and performance.

Q3. Does clearing the update cache delete my files?

No, it only resets update-related data.

Q4. Why does my laptop freeze during updates?

This may happen due to corrupted files or failing hardware.
